Wood Burning Stove UK

Wood burning stoves in the UK can add a cosy touch to your home. They are also environmentally friendly. Many people are worried about the carbon dioxide emissions generated by the stove, but modern wood burning stoves are extremely efficient.

Ecodesign wood-burning stoves are known for their low emissions and their high efficiency in energy use. They meet the new carbon dioxide guidelines levels, which will be implemented in 2022.

Costs

The cost of a wood-burning stove will vary depending on its design and type. The best way to get the best price for your new stove is to look around for prices and services. small Wood burning Stoves uk traders or one-man shops often charge less than large companies with overheads. The price also depends on the location. Installing a stove in London is more expensive than elsewhere.

Another crucial aspect to consider when deciding on a wood burner is to ensure that it meets UK building regulations. This includes how the flue is positioned and the distance to any combustible material. A trained professional should be able to assist you in this process.

A log fireplace is a fantastic addition to any home. They're not just beautiful, but can also provide warmth in winter. They also serve as an attractive focal point in the room. They can also help you save money on your energy bills. Additionally wood stoves can help keep the air in your home. However the use of wood as a fuel source has been linked to deforestation and climate change.

The cost of wood burning stove of energy is rising and it seems like our government's promises to freeze them are pushed back every year. A wood-burning stove could be a way to free your home from the shackles of the energy companies. The price may fluctuate with the cost of firewood, but it is still cheaper than gas or electricity.

The cost of installing a stove is contingent on the size of your home and the type of fireplace you choose. It is recommended to talk to several installers and read about their work before choosing one. This will give you an idea of the price.

Verify that the installer is insured. You'll be protected in the event of a problem during installation. Find out how long it will take to complete the project. While a typical installation will take 1-2 days while a complete renovation could take as long as 5-7 days.

Energy efficiency

Wood burning stoves are an excellent source of heat and energy especially in winter when the cost of fuel is high. They can aid families in saving money on heating costs and are eco-friendly. However, it is essential to choose the correct stove for your home. It is important to select a stove that is compliant with the requirements of building codes and has a kW output based on the dimensions of your space. This will prevent you from underfiring or overfiring, which could cause expensive damage to your chimney and flue.

Wood stoves come in a variety of styles and are very popular in the UK. Some homeowners make use of wood stoves as their primary source of heating, whereas others mix them with other sources of energy. Many people gather recycled or reclaimed wood to use in their stoves, and this can be an excellent option to save money and reduce your carbon footprint. You can also find reclaimed wood from construction sites or dumps and a lot of suppliers offer sustainable wood, which means that a tree is planted for each one that is felled for energy purposes.

A fireplace that burns wood will increase the efficiency of your home heating and can help you save money on fuel. The majority of modern stoves have an efficiency rating of 60 to 80%, so you will only require only a small amount of wood for small wood Burning stoves uk them to produce enough heat for your entire home. Wood is an energy source that is renewable and will never ever run out.

Ecodesign Ready stoves are a fantastic way to make your wood stove more energy efficient. These are stoves that comply with European standards for air pollution and particle emission. If you reside in a smoke-free area, you can choose a Defra exempt stove. These stoves are designed to burn logs and approved smokeless fuels in areas that are controlled.

The efficiency of your wood stove will be contingent on what fuel you use and how well-insulated your home is. Most species of wood have a similar energy content on a per-pound basis when dry. Some types of wood are more expensive, however, they have a greater heat to weight ratio.

Heat output

It is important to think about the amount of heat your stove can generate for your home when you select a stove. The output of the heat source is typically stated in the product description, or prominently mentioned in the name. The figure will be followed by a 'kW' - this is the nominal amount of kilowatts that the stove is capable of supplying to your home over a long time.

Many manufacturers offer an online stove calculator that can assist you in determining what size stove is suitable for your home, and how much heat the stove can provide over a specific time. It is crucial to ensure that you do not purchase an electric stove that is too powerful and can cause high energy bills.

The most efficient wood burning stoves require less wood and produce less smoke, therefore they are a better option for the environment than traditional open fires. However, they can be a significant source for small particles of air pollution (PM2.5) which can lead to asthma and other respiratory ailments. Using an air filtration system can help reduce the negative effects.

Wood burning stoves are an excellent option for heating your home as they burn natural, carbon neutral fuel that is renewable. In addition they can also be used to generate hot water for the central heating system.

Unlike electric heaters, wood burners are an economical way to heat your home by having one wood burner generating more heat than the average gas or electricity stove. It is crucial to keep up with the amount of wood needed to fuel your stove.

Many people decide to install a wood burning stove for saving money on heating bills. According to a study conducted by a consumer group Which? 43% of fireplaces wood burning stoves burning stove owners believe that their stoves helped them save money. They also provide an excellent alternative to central heating systems, with some homeowners even making use of them to cover all their heating requirements.

When buying a stove, you must always search for the Ecodesign or clearSkies certification, which ensures that the stove is environmentally friendly. The newer standard clearSkies has higher standards for stoves. It starts at level two and works to levels five.

Maintenance

Many wood stove owners do not know the basic maintenance that is required to keep their appliances operating effectively and safely. These include daily weekly, monthly, and daily cleaning of the chimney, as and periodic servicing of the stove. Before starting any of these tasks, it is essential to ensure that the stove is cold and that there are no burning embers.

Regularly wipe down the stove doors with microfibre cloths, or a product specifically designed for this for this purpose. The majority of home improvement stores sell these products. These products are typically affordable and safe to use, as they don't contain substances that can harm the surface of your stove. It is also advisable to keep the door slightly open during periods of inactivity that allows air to circulate, and also prevents corrosion.

The rope seal around the stove's door should be checked frequently for small wood Burning stoves uk the condition and flatness. If the rope becomes too stretched, it will not create a strong seal. Test the smoke flap to confirm that it can be closed without much effort. This can be accomplished by moving a lit candle around the edges of the smoke flap. when the flame is attracted to it, it is not sealing properly.

All homes must have smoke and CO alarms. They should be placed near every room where a stove is being utilized, and checked every month. Additionally an extinguisher that is class A should be readily accessible in case of any problems with the stove.

Over time, the grate and baffle plate of the stove will wear out and require replacement. To ensure that your stove runs efficiently, it's a good practice to clean the baffle every week and take away ash from the grate every couple of days. The glass of the stove must be cleaned frequently, too, with a cloth or other cleaning products designed specifically for this purpose.

Although it is possible to service a wood burning stove yourself however, it is recommended to hire a Hetas certified installer with years of experience in maintenance and service for solid fuels.
